Peoples Gazette Vs Peter Obi: Sowore Backs Platform, Warns Against Lawsuit

 

Omoyele Sowore, the presidential candidate of the African Action Congress (AAC) in the February 25 election, has predicted more difficulties for his Labour Party (LP) counterpart, Peter Obi, should Obi insist on filing a lawsuit against the Nigerian digital news outlet Peoples Gazette for leaking his alleged phone conversation with Bishop David Oyedepo.

In recent days, the audio recording of an alleged phone conversation between Obi and the founder of the Living Faith Church had gone viral in the media.

Obi issued a lengthy statement via his Twitter account on Wednesday evening in response to the ‘Yes Daddy’ audio, which has elicited a barrage of responses. He described the alleged leaked tape as fake and doctored.

 

Obi allegedly described the 2023 presidential election as a religious war and urged Bishop Oyedepo to help him mobilise Christian votes, according to a leaked audio recording.

In his response on Wednesday, Obi denied the authenticity of the phone conversation and revealed he had instructed his attorneys to take legal action against the news outlet that first published the alleged recording.

Sowore, on the other hand, has criticised the former governor of Anambra State, claiming that his threat to sue Peoples Gazette will be his greatest error.

He wrote on his Twitter page;

“The whole threat of a defamation/lawsuit by Peter Obi against @GazetteNGR will be his worst mistake, worse than his misadventures in politics and tomfoolery. A lawyer fresh out of Law School will make a mincemeat of the LYING MACHINE in court. I am standing with @GazetteNGR and hope they don’t let any pressure make them capitulate. I know for sure @Peterobi won’t sue nadir over his YES DADDY “Religious War” phone scandal. it is all huffing and puffing to scare @GazetteNGR,”.
